Install Homebrew
Paste that in a macOS Terminal or Linux shell prompt.The script explains what it will do and then pauses before it does it. Read about other installation options.What Does Homebrew Do?
Homebrew installs the stuff you need that Apple (or your Linux system) didn’t.- Homebrew installs packages to their own directory and then symlinks their files into
/usr/local
. - Homebrew won’t install files outside its prefix and you can place a Homebrew installation wherever you like.
- It's all Git and Ruby underneath, so hack away with the knowledge that you can easily revert your modifications and merge upstream updates.
- Homebrew complements macOS (or your Linux system). Install your RubyGems with
gem
and their dependencies withbrew
. - 'To install, drag this icon..' no more.
brew cask
installs macOS apps, fonts and plugins and other non-open source software. Donate to Homebrew

mysql is a simple SQL shell with input line editing capabilities. It supports interactive and noninteractive use. When used interactively, query results are presented in an ASCII-table format. When used noninteractively (for example, as a filter), the result is presented in tab-separated format. The output format can be changed using command options.
If you have problems due to insufficient memory for large result sets, use the
--quick
option. This forces mysql to retrieve results from the server a row at a time rather than retrieving the entire result set and buffering it in memory before displaying it. This is done by returning the result set using the mysql_use_result()
C API function in the client/server library rather than mysql_store_result()
